Fashion's Influence on Interiors

From the bold hues adorning a room to the eclectic textures used in furnishings, fashion's influence on interior design is undeniable. Tastes that captivate the runway often mirror themselves in our homes, creating spaces that are as sophisticated as they are functional. A modern aesthetic might echo the clean lines and bold color palettes of a recent fashion collection. Conversely, a room bursting with antique charm could be inspired by a boho trend in clothing. This constant dialogue between fashion and interior design ensures that our homes remain dynamic reflections of our personal tastes.
